Chinese games achieve great success overseas
By:Huang Qingyang  |  From:english.eastday.com  |  2020-08-03 13:53

Chinese game manufacturers have made an outstanding achievement in the gaming industries overseas in recent years, among which Shanghai Lilith Technology Corporation received enormous success for its game AFK Arena in South Korea. In February this year the game had been downloaded more than 800,000 times and its turnover reached nearly 7 million dollars.

After Lilith Games had developed one of the best-selling mobile games in China, in 2016 the company switched its focus to overseas gaming markets. Two of its games have been on the top ten list of the most profitable Chinese games overseas. Rise of Kingdoms entered the Japanese market in December last year and immediately became one of the top three most populargames ontheIOS game list. Its estimated annual revenue has reached 458 million dollars.

The reason for these games’success lies in their concept of maintaining high quality all the time. Hu Rui, vice president of Lilith Games said that although mobile games seem to be quite easy and simple, every loop from development to management is carefully designed to adapt to the Otaku economy. The game settings aim to offer as much fun as possible to players in fragments of time. It tries to adapt to players’habits when they are playing and its style also suits the international common taste.

Besides the improvement in funding and technology, Chinese games’success overseas should also be attributed to their work on localization. As a marketing strategy, Lilith Games promotes its new games in South Korea using celebrity endorsements like movie stars and E-sports champions with satisfying results. “We should respect the uniqueness and independence of our targeted market when we try to expand business there. When games are about to be introduced into the globalized market, localization must be done based on different cultural backgrounds, values, social environments and conventions, languages and so on”, said Hu Rui.

However, in order to make further progress in the overseasgaming market, companies should keep innovating and improving the whole gaming experience to create a deeper emotional bondwith players. In 2017, Lilith Games developed the successful independent game Abi, which reflects on the relationship between environmental protection and the fate of humanity based on a robot’s story. In the following years Lilith Games has been launching high quality independent games designed for teenagers worldwide annually. According to Hu, independent games that emphasize on feelings and thoughts can contribute more to our society.

Statistics have shown that last year the profits of the gaming industry in Shanghai reached about 80 billion dollars or 200 million yuan, among which the profits made from online overseas games reached 10 billion dollars or 34 million yuan, an increase of nearly 26%. The development of information industries, Internet infrastructures and talent resources have made Shanghai a perfect place for game manufacturers in China.
